而在眾多操作系統中,Linux以其開源、靈活、安全等特性,成為了無數開發者、技術愛好者乃至企業級應用的首選
當你決定踏入Linux的世界,迎接你的不僅是一個全新的操作系統,更是一場通往高效與自由之旅的起點
本文將帶你深入了解Linux,從初次接觸、安裝配置到日常使用,一步步引領你走進這個充滿魅力的數字世界首頁
一、初識Linux:開源的自由之魂 Linux,這個名字源自計算機科學家林納斯·托瓦茲(Linus Torvalds)的姓氏,同時巧妙地借鑒了Unix操作系統的命名風格,自1991年問世以來,便以其開源的特性迅速吸引了全球范圍內的開發者關注
與Windows或macOS不同,Linux的核心——內核,以及大多數應用程序都是免費開放源代碼的,這意味著任何人都可以查看、修改并分發這些代碼,這種開放的精神促進了技術的快速迭代與創新
開源不僅僅是技術層面的優勢,它更象征著一種文化的傳承
在Linux社區,分享知識、互助合作是常態,無論是初學者還是資深專家,都能在這里找到歸屬感
這種文化氛圍,使得Linux成為了一個不斷進化、充滿活力的生態系統
二、安裝Linux:打造個性化數字空間 踏入Linux世界的第一步,通常是從安裝一個Linux發行版(Distro)開始的
Linux發行版是基于Linux內核構建的完整操作系統,它們各有特色,滿足不同用戶的需求
比如,Ubuntu以其友好的用戶界面和強大的社區支持而廣受歡迎;Fedora則注重技術創新,經常引入最新的軟件版本;而Debian以其穩定性和廣泛的軟件包倉庫著稱
安裝Linux通常包括下載ISO鏡像文件、使用U盤或DVD制作啟動盤、配置BIOS/UEFI以從啟動盤啟動、按照屏幕提示完成分區、安裝等步驟
對于初學者而言,這個過程可能稍顯復雜,但得益于詳盡的在線教程和社區支持,即便是技術小白也能順利完成安裝
安裝完成后,你可以根據個人喜好定制桌面環境,安裝必要的軟件,如文本編輯器、瀏覽器、辦公軟件等
Linux的桌面環境(如GNOME、KDE)提供了豐富的主題、圖標集和窗口管理器選項,讓你的操作系統既實用又美觀
三、日常使用:高效與自由的實踐 Linux系統的日常體驗,是其魅力所在
以下幾點,將幫助你更好地理解和享受Linux帶來的高效與自由
1.終端的力量:終端(Terminal)是Linux系統的核心,它提供了直接與系統交互的命令行界面
通過終端,你可以執行各種管理任務,如文件管理、用戶管理、軟件包安裝與更新等
掌握一些基本的命令行技巧,如`ls`列出目錄內容、`cd`切換目錄、`sudo`獲取超級用戶權限、`apt-get`或`yum`安裝軟件包等,將極大地提升你的工作效率
2.軟件包的自由:Linux擁有龐大的軟件包倉庫,如Debian的APT、Fedora的DNF、Arch Linux的pacman等,這些倉庫提供了數以萬計的應用程序,從開發工具到辦公軟件,從圖形處理到科學計算,應有盡有
更重要的是,由于源代碼的開放性,用戶可以自行編譯安裝軟件,甚至創建自己的軟件包,實現真正的個性化定制
3.安全與穩定:Linux系統因其開源特性,能夠快速響應安全漏洞,發布補丁
同時,由于Linux系統架構的設計,使得它天生具有較低的病毒感染率,這為用戶提供了一個相對安全的工作環境
此外,Linux的穩定性也是其一大亮點,一旦配置妥當,很少需要重啟,這對于服務器和長時間運行的任務尤為重要
4.強大的社區支持:Linux的成功,離不開其背后的強大社區
無論是遇到技術難題,還是想要學習新的技能,Linux社區都是最好的資源
論壇、郵件列表、IRC聊天室、Stack Overflow等平臺,匯聚了來自世界各地的開發者和技術愛好者,他們樂于分享知識,幫助他人解決問題
四、進階探索:解鎖Linux的無限可能 隨著對Linux的深入使用,你可能會想要探索更多高級功能,比如服務器配置、編程開發、系統優化等
- 服務器配置:Linux是服務器領域的佼佼者,無論是Web服務器(如Apache、Nginx)、數據庫服務器(如MySQL、PostgreSQL),還是文件服務器、郵件服務器,Linux都能勝任
學習如何使用SSH遠程登錄、配置防火墻(如iptables或ufw)、管理用戶和權限等,將幫助你更好地管理服務器資源
- 編程開發:Linux是編程開發者的天堂,它支持幾乎所有主流編程語言,并且擁有強大的開發工具鏈,如GC